Transaction d93ae7829e098af3e0b2dc0949bd4a03fce73f8e7aa12b48756190dfe20cb212
3 Input
2 Outputs
- d93ae7829e098af3e0b2dc0949bd4a03fce73f8e7aa12b48756190dfe20cb212:0
- d93ae7829e098af3e0b2dc0949bd4a03fce73f8e7aa12b48756190dfe20cb212:1
value 698542
address 12QrZkff5ovP8KYgrtNXCpVss8KWHhe3cc
value 2165062
address 174aeGdKAdtnCvDL8HipiGVWSUaHpdLD4R